Real Estate to Level the Neighborhood on New Label; Album to Drop in October
The village natives are currently on their European tour
Ridgewood's native indie rockers Real Estate are hopping around Europe right now, but Impose Magazine says they'll be back stateside in July and will have a new album dropping just before Halloween. Also new is the band's label; Impose reports they've signed onto Domino Records. The Pitchfork darlings had a in 2009.
Catch the band when they return to the area on July 23 and 24. They'll be rocking the Prospect Park Bandshell in their new Brooklyn stomping grounds on the 23rd with Dent May but they'll be back in New Jersey at Hoboken's Maxwell's on the 24th with The Feelies & Times New Viking.
While you're at it, check out guitarist Matthew Mondalile's band Ducktails and Alex Bleeker and The Freaks led by none other than bassist Alex Bleeker.
